Mark Gillman Posted October 19, 2022 Report Share Posted October 19, 2022 Well Its been 3 months since I brewed the Sparkling Ale and I have sampled about 7 bottles along the way. This week I purchased some 440ml cans for a side by side trial....my thoughts are as follows:- No Home Brew twang from Beerdroid brew. Head retention not as good as the packaged beer. Fell short of the real stuff but only minor. I could taste a Marzipan flavour. It was about 80 to 90% like Coopers Sparkling Ale. All up it wasn't a bad drop and I look forward to the remaining brews. 1 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
